Default Water Pump connector

Does anyone know where I can get another electrical connector for my CSR water pump? We are re-wiring a car and need the part of the quick disconnect electrical connector that stays with the car. I believe it is the female portion. I have looked on Jegs and Summit and can't find it. They might know if I called them, but I haven't done that yet.

Why not convert to a weatherpack type connector. Jegs has a kit from Caspers Electronics #182-103005 Weatherpack Connector Kit for racer price of $62. It has all the connectors and parts you will need to make the connections. It makes borrowing a part difficult, but i like the Weatherpack connectors and have my spare stuff already changed over with soldered connections.

I thought about that. I actually have a weatherpak kit, but I want to keep them standard. I have found that it is much easier to keep things with factory connectors if you are going to have to swap them out in a hurry.

I found that the SPAL automotive fan that i have has the same connectors. SPAL has a 24" pigtail for $8.95. The connector is a TYCO #926474.
